2.2 Multi-Key Commands

In addition to the standard front panel controls detailed in 2.1, the Aurora has been programmed so that
extended functionality is available through the use of multi-key combinations, or by pressing a button
down while AC power is applied. The sections below detail these key combinations and the firmware
required for each to operate.

Power Up State

This command changes the power up state of the Aurora from STANDBY (the default) to ON. In
STANDBY mode, when AC power is applied, the POWER button must be pressed before the unit will
become operational. In ON mode, when AC power is applied the Aurora will be ready to use. ON is
the ideal setting when a single power switch is used to turn on an equipment rack.

To activate, hold the POWER button while connecting AC power. PLEASE NOTE: After the mode
is changed the unit must be put into standby mode to save this setting before power is removed again.
This function requires firmware revision 11 or higher in order to operate.

Restore Defaults

This command returns the Aurora to its factory default condition. SYNC SOURCE, ROUTING,
TRIM, AES states, etc. will all be impacted. This is a useful diagnostic step whenever performance
problems are encountered. To activate, press the SAMPLE RATE button while AC Power is applied.
This function requires firmware revision 11 or higher in order to operate.

Verify Firmware Revision

This command will display the current firmware version of the Aurora. In standby mode, press the
TRIM and POWER buttons simultaneously. The LEDs in the PEAK METER display will blink, and
the LED over one or two channels will flash repeatedly. This is the number of the active firmware
version. This function requires firmware revision 13 or higher in order to operate.

Dual Wire Select Mode

This command allows selection of the Dual Wire state for the Aurora’s AES digital channels. In this
Mode, when the METER button is set to “DIGITAL”, Dual Wire In and Dual Wire Out can be enabled
with the TRIM/AES MODE button. To activate, press the TRIM/AES MODE button while AC Power
is applied. To deactivate, turn the Aurora OFF and then back ON with the STANDBY button.
